So you want to instigate a community garden in your ‘hood? Jump on the bandwagon.
The Vacant Property Working Group is holding a “how to” workshop Monday from 6 to 8 p.m. and will have a mess (sorry, it’s bean season) of local community garden practitioners on hand to give you inspiration and information. It’s in the conference room of the Pittsburgh Community Reinvestment Group (the vacant property group is its spawn), 1901 Centre Ave. Suite 200. Light snacks will be provided.

Topics will include how to get the land ready, options for buying, city programming around land revitalization, volunteer and resource management, planting and maintaining a food garden and other technical considerations. Representatives from Grow Pittsburgh, the Western Pennsylvania Conservancy; the mayor’s office of neighborhood initiatives, the GreenUp Program and Homewood Community Garden will be there.
